Masimo CEO on Apple Patent Fight, Blue Origin Returns to Space

Bloomberg's Caroline Hyde sits down with the CEO of medical technology firm Masimo amid its patent dispute with Apple. Plus, Blue Origin’s space tourism rocket voyages to space and back for the first time in 15 months. And, Alphabet reaches a $700 million settlement with states over claims that its app store unlawfully dominates the Android mobile applications market.
